Key Buying Points

Ultra-high suction: 13,000 Pa Vormax suction adapts between hard floors and carpets for deep cleaning.

Removable & liftable mop: Enables thorough scrubbing with automatic mop lifting on carpets to prevent dampening.

Auto-empty + auto-refill dock (PowerDock): Hands-free maintenance, with base washing/drying of pads and water refilling options.

TriCut Brush: Optimizes hair management by directing hair into the dust box, reducing tangles.

Smart carpet cleaning: Ultrasonic carpet sensing with automatic suction boost for carpets and prevention of over-wetting.

Accurate mapping & obstacle avoidance: Smart Pathfinder creates editable maps with precise navigation and obstacle detection.

Voice & app control: Full control via app and compatible voice assistants for convenient scheduling and cleaning.

The Catch

Premium price may be a hurdle for budget buyers seeking basic cleaning without mopping.

App setup and multi-floor configuration can be intimidating for non-tech users.

Customer service experiences reported as inconsistent or slow by some users.

Auto-fill module required for water refilling is sold separately, adding to total cost.

Mop pad maintenance and potential need for additional accessories like the TriCut brush.

Common Questions & Expert Insights

Q: Deal-breaker: Is auto-emptying reliable long-term?
Yes, auto-emptying helps long-term hands-off use, but you may still need periodic bag replacement. In practice, the PowerDock empties into a bag, reducing frequent emptying; some users report occasional maintenance on the bag or sensors.)
Q: Deal-breaker: Is the app setup confusing?
No, setup is straightforward for typical users, with a guided app flow. Most users map floors quickly; some note a learning curve for multi-floor configurations.)
Q: Deal-breaker: How is customer service?
Customer service can be hit-or-miss, sometimes slow to respond. Warranty and support experiences vary; be prepared for potential delays in getting help.)
Q: Tech/Compatibility: Does it work with Google Assistant / Alexa?
Limited voice assistant integration; control is mainly via app or native commands. Google Home support is basic and not room-specific in many cases.)
Q: Tech/Compatibility: Can it map multiple stories or levels?
Yes, it supports multi-floor mapping and per-level maps. You can save maps, manage no-go zones, and switch floors in the app.)
Q: Tech/Compatibility: Does it auto-detect carpet and lift mop?
Yes, it uses carpet sensing to boost suction and lift the mop on carpets. This prevents damp carpets and optimizes cleaning on mixed surfaces.)
Q: Maintenance: How hard is cleaning the TriCut Brush?
Relatively easy; the TriCut Brush is designed to minimize hair tangles and is simple to clean or replace. Regular brushing helps keep performance consistent.)
Q: Maintenance: How often to replace mop pads or water/detergent?
Mop pads are reusable but require periodic cleaning and replacement as needed. The base washes/drys pads to reduce maintenance, but wear will occur with heavy use.)
Q: Comparison: Is it better than Roomba at scrubbing floors?
In many setups, it offers stronger wet mopping and smarter mapping than mid-range Roombas. For households needing wet cleaning, it often outperforms basic robotic mops.)
Q: Comparison: How does it compare to other premium robots for price/performance?
Typically strong performance at a lower price than flagship brands. It delivers flagship-like features (mopping, self-cleaning dock) with competitive pricing.)
